WTP helps SaaS companies choose optimum prices for their products to maximize profit. SaaS product teams also use it to prioritize features and evaluate the feasibility of new motions. Willingness To Pay (WTP) is a concept from pricing research studies describing the maximum price the customer is ready to pay for the product.
